How to Spot the Real Deal from the Junk

Not all non Gamstop casinos are created equal. Some are fantastic. Some are garbage. Here’s what I look for:

  • Licensing: Check if they hold a Curacao eGaming license or a Malta Gaming Authority license. Curacao is common, but MGA is more reputable.
  • Game providers: Look for names like NetEnt, Microgaming, Play’n GO, Evolution Gaming. If the games are from unknown providers, walk away.
  • Withdrawal times: The best sites process withdrawals within 24 hours for e-wallets. If it says 3-5 business days, they’re probably slow.
  • Customer support: Test the live chat. If they don’t answer within 2 minutes, it’s a red flag.
  • Player reviews: Check forums like AskGamblers or ThePogg. See what real players are saying.

I’ve been burned before by a site that looked great but took 2 weeks to process a withdrawal. Learn from my mistakes.
